Java http 客户端和 POODLE
全部标签 我在单个应用程序中有2个主要入口点。第一个main启动服务器,映射Controller并启动一些工作线程。这些工作人员从云队列接收消息。如果负载增加,我希望能够添加额外的工作人员来完成我的工作。所以我在我的应用程序中有一个secondMain入口点,我希望能够在spring-boot(作为客户端应用程序)中启动而不启动默认服务器,以便以避免端口冲突(显然这会导致失败)。我如何实现这一目标? 最佳答案 使用server和client配置文件从命令行启动要使用具有2个不同配置文件的相同jar和相同入口点,您应该在运行时简单地提供Spri
我正在尝试与一些具有基本身份验证的SOAPWeb服务进行交互,并且我有URL、用户名和密码。现在我想在我的java代码中使用这个web服务,所以我需要为它创建一个jar文件。我看到了下面的URL,但不确定我是否遵循了它。http://axis.apache.org/axis2/java/core/docs/userguide-creatingclients.html#choosingclienthttp://javasourcecodeetc.blogspot.com/2011/07/convert-wsdl-to-java-for-calling-soap.html我已经从中下载了a
是否有任何理由避免在非测试环境中使用rest-assured?该库提供的用于创建和解析请求的语法非常紧凑,仅在测试中使用它似乎是一种浪费。哪一种回避了问题,为什么它单独作为测试工具? 最佳答案 我是RESTAssured的创始人,它一直主要针对测试。例如,默认端口是8080,它附带Hamcrest匹配器(它也在内部使用,因此不能排除)并且性能可能会有所优化。它还依赖于Groovy,如果您只需要一个HTTP客户端,那么将其添加到生产系统中可能是一个相当大的依赖项。人们,有时包括我自己,都在生产中使用它,因为它使用起来简单灵活。并非所有
最近研究了一段时间的openvpn组网技术,也试着搭建了一个openvpn环境,大概理解了其中使用的一些技术原理,还是记录一下。本篇文章对专业搞网络的人也许用处不大,但是对于初次接触这些技术(比如vpn,代理技术,加密隧道,防火墙,路由,局域网组网)的人还是有一定价值的,便于理清整个vpn组网技术的脉络,也可以在遇到问题的时候自己排查。 openvpn是众多vpn种类的一种,是一个开源的产品,也是应用最广泛的一种vpn。支持的平台很多,我们常用的系统平台linux,window,安卓都支持。我搭建的openvpn服务端是运行在centos上,客户端是运行在安卓手机上的。其实不管运行在
HermesJMS有哪些替代品可用?我需要针对JBossWildFly8进行测试,它使用Java8。HermesJms似乎是为Java6构建的,我找不到它的完整Java8端口。我尝试使用thisconfigurationoption设置hermes.bat但我收到以下错误:org.xml.sax.SAXNotRecognizedException:Feature'http://javax.xml.XMLConstants/feature/secure-processing'isnotrecognized.这似乎是由于XercesJAR版本,但我担心%HERMES_HOME%\lib\e
我正在尝试以客户端/服务器方式制作Java应用程序。客户端是SWT中的一个GUI,它显示来自服务器的数据。服务器连接到数据库。好的,很抱歉,我确定这是一个经典问题,但我不知道如何开始。在我工作的一个项目中,他们使用Proxy.newProxyInstance()实现了很多魔法来透明地调用Glassfish服务器。我不想使用Glassfish服务器。我只想要简单的Java语言。但是代理的概念似乎很酷。你有这样的想法或例子吗?如何编写服务器部分来处理客户端的请求?提前致谢弗鲁米尼 最佳答案 我要解释一下TCP:基本概念是您必须在机器上运
我正在使用apachehttp客户端来测试我的WS。我已经写了一个getWSinjersey。这个WS的URL是http://localhost:8080/mobilestore/rest/sysgestockmobilews/getinventory?xml=dataString要使用url调用此WS,我编写了如下方法publicstaticvoidgetInventory(Stringinput)throwsClientProtocolException,IOException{System.out.println(input);Stringurl=URL+"getinventor
我有一个使用RESTEasy的简单客户端,如下所示:publicclassTest{publicstaticvoidmain(String[]args){ResteasyClientclient=newResteasyClientBuilder().build();ResteasyWebTargettarget=client.target("http://localhost");client.register(newMyMapper());MyProxyproxy=target.proxy(MyProxy.class);Stringr=proxy.getTest();}}publici
350赏金和华夫饼送给能帮助我的人!我一直在为Spring苦苦挣扎Web服务加密好几天了,我不知道如何让Spring对消息正文进行加密。每当我让服务器加密生成的消息时,客户端在尝试根据架构(XSD)验证它之前似乎并没有解密它。HereistheserversideconfigurationTheserver'sxwsssecurityconfigurationTheclient'sSpringconfigurationClient'sxwssconfiguration我能做的就是加密用户token并成功解密。我在从客户端向服务器发送数据时这样做。然后服务器解密用户token并验证用户凭
这是我目前所知道的(请纠正我):在RabbitMQJava客户端中,对channel的操作抛出IOException当出现一般网络故障时(来自代理的格式错误的数据、身份验证失败、错过的心跳)。对channel的操作也可以抛出ShutdownSignalException未经检查的异常,通常是AlreadyClosedException当我们尝试在channel/连接关闭后对其执行操作时。关闭过程发生在"networkfailure,internalfailureorexplicitlocalshutdown"事件中(例如,通过channel.close()或connection.clo